Transaction 88616bcb05b89883a73ba7762f6599991a8c489f36167bfb1a116c5568933eb9
1 Input
1 Output
-
88616bcb05b89883a73ba7762f6599991a8c489f36167bfb1a116c5568933eb9:0
- value
- 604323
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d18b3a138a8652a6336e1f55db23015750331ec
- address
- bc1q05vt8gfc4pjj5ceku864mv3sz46sxv0vee866x